LONDON (ShareCast) - A pretty flat morning in New York as the oil sector dragged down equities following a profit warning by Baker Hughes .
Ben Bernanke and Tim Geithner, Federal Reserve Chairman and Treasury Secretary respectively, have made great play of the differences between the US and European economies. Both have made clear that the United States is in a much stronger position than Europe.
Geithner said: "The main risk for the U.S. is that the large European countries endure a long period of weak economic growth."
Bernanke said US banks are in a “more solid” position than two years ago. He cautioned, though, that the increase in energy prices could affect "short-term economic growth."
ECONOMY
Previously occupied home sales fell in February by 0.9% to 4.59 million units, according to data released by the National Association of Realtors (NAR). The consensus was for a rise of 0.7%.
According to the NAR's chief economist, Lawrence Yun: "The underlying factors are much stronger than a year ago. The market moves upward unevenly..."
BUSINESS
Hewlett-Packard will combine its imaging and printing division with the personal systems unit, in order to cut costs.
Hartford Financial Services has sold much of its life insurance business to focus on Property and Casualty Insurance.
Goldman Sachs has raised its recommendation on LinkedIn to buy from neutral.
Baker Hughes says its first quarter pre-tax earnings will be lower than the previous three months due to the "changing" market.
OTHER MARKETS
May futures contracts on a barrel of West Texas crude gained 0.61% to $107.46 on the NYMEX.
The yield on 10-year treasuries dropped 5 basis points to 2.31%.
The euro is down -0.15% against the dollar at $ 1.3206.
